Severed Limbs - "Parts Characters in Poser"

NOTE: This was written for Poser 4, but is still applicable today.

RDNA Tutorials

Severed Limbs - "Parts Characters in Poser" Want just the wings off that Dragon, or do you want to give Posette or Vickie an extra set of arms?Well here is a simple technique to do just that. Start making your own Frankenstein creations today!

This works for poser 3, 4, Pro Pack, or P5, so no matter the version you can use this technique.

Tools Needed: UVMapper A Plain old text editor (I use Word Pad) Poser

PART 1: Making the Object File

-Open up UVMapper and import the base geometry file for the Poser 4 Woman. This can be found in:

Poser 4/Runtime/Geometries/P4NudeWoman/

-Once the .obj has loaded Hit Ctrl-G and the list of groups will pop up. Select all of the parts that are not the arms, hands or fingers. Hit ok, and then when you are back out in the main window, hit the Delete key. You will get a warning box asking if you want to do this, hit yes. You should be looking at only the hands arms and fingers now.(I kept the Collars on as a base for my arms)

-Save this new file in the same dir as the P4 Woman's and name it arms.obj or something of the like.

PART 2: Editing the .CR2

If you have never done this before, it can make some people a little nervous. A .cr2 (and most of the poser files) are actuallytext files that tell poser what it needs to know.

-Open your text editor and load the P4 fem's .cr2 from the following dir.

Poser 4/Runtime/libraries/characters/people -Immediately save this as JustArms.cr2 so you don't accidently overwrite your P4 Fem's .cr2.

-Now once saved with the new name, look for a line that looks like this:

figureResFile :Runtime:Geometries:P4NudeWoman:P4NudeWom.obj

It will be there at the top under some {'s , }'s , and Version info.This is the line that tells poser what .obj file it is working from.To point this at your new arms, chage it to:

figureResFile :Runtime:Geometries:P4NudeWoman:arms.obj

-Save it again as JustArms.cr2 and exit the text editor.

PART 3: Using the .cr2 in Poser

-Open poser, get rid of the default character, and go looking for the new arms character (Should be in the People Section) Load the new character. It will take a minute or two as it builds a .rsr file for the arms. Once it is done you should be looking at a set of arms only in the window.

-You are done!

NOTES: These arms take the normal texture files and have the same materials set up as the P4 fem, so you can change them like you normally do. Also because the part names remain the same, Poses work just fine on them too.

ADDED NOTES: This same technique can be used to lop off parts of animal models, so if you wanted to have Wings off a bird model, you can do that or a tail off the cat, etc.
